25 | On 5/11/26,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Anna Morales conducted am Unannounced random inspection, and was met with Licensee Yelena Rey. Licensee stated that she is the only adult that reside at the facility. LPA observed six preschool aged children being present. Licensee was operating within her capacity and ratio requirements. LPA observed the required postings, including the facility license. Days and hours of operation are Monday to Friday, 7:30am- 5:30pm. Licensee doesn't provide transportation to the children at this time. Licensee provides breakfast, lunch and snacks. LPA observed a current Children's roster. Last disaster drill was conducted on 5/11/26/
Licensee was reminded that all adults 18 and over living or working in the home, including employees and volunteers, except as specified in Health and Safety Code section 1596.871, must obtain a criminal record clearance or exemption, or transfer their existing clearance or exemption, prior to initial presence in a licensed Family Child Care Home. A civil penalty of $100.00 minimum/day for a maximum of 5 days or, if the penalty is for a repeat violation, for a maximum of 30 days per person will be assessed if this regulation is violated.
LPA toured the indoor and outdoor areas of the home during today's visit. The Licensee has a working telephone in the home. The home is clean, orderly, including heating and air conditioning, for safety & comfort. LPA observed combo smoke & carbon monoxide detectors, and a 3A10BC Fire Extinguisher. No bodies of water observed. Observed sufficient toys, play equipment, and materials for day care children. Licensee stated that she does not have any weapons/ammunition in the home. Children have access to living room(day care), bedroom in day care area, hallway bathroom and dining area. The kitchen is off limits and second bedroom.
